01-Spring框架模块与获取

nobility 发布于 2022-03-15 1728 次阅读


Spring框架模块与获取

模块

spring overview

Spring将单独功能进行抽离,每个单独的小模块对应一个jar包,上层模块依赖下层模块,下面是对Spring-Framework大模块进行的解释

  • Test:测试集成模块
  • Core Container:核心容器模块
  • AOP和Aspects:面向切面编程模块
  • Data Access/Integration:数据访问/集成模块
  • Web:SpringMVC模块

获取Spring

将下面的依赖代码加入pom.xml文件中,也可从Spring官方获取jar包导入,依次点击左侧菜单中libs-release-local > org > springframework > spring > x.x.x.RELEASE,右击spring-x.x.x-dist.zipdownload即可下载,也可以从Spring官方仓库直接选择版本进行下载

一般使用Maven引入spring-context和spring-aspects就会将所有核心模块IOC和AOP全部引入

<dependency>
  <groupId>org.springframework</groupId>
  <artifactId>spring-xxx</artifactId>  <!--引入单独小模块的jar包-->
  <version>x.x.x</version>  <!--所有单独小模块的jar包版本最好保持一致-->
</dependency>
此作者没有提供个人介绍
最后更新于 2022-03-15